Step-by-Step Directions
1. Draw the Primary Shapes
Start by sketching two triangles for the outer ears. Make the triangles barely curved on the perimeters and pointed on the high. Place them facet by facet, with a small hole between them. These triangles will kind the bottom of the cat ears.
2. Draw the Inside Ears
Inside the outer ear triangles, draw two smaller, curved triangles for the interior ears. These interior triangles ought to curve inward and align with the curve of the outer ears. They need to be barely shorter than the outer triangles and have a rounded level on the high.
Subsequent, add a tiny oval form inside every interior ear. This oval will symbolize the ear canal. Draw a small dot inside the oval to outline the interior ear’s heart.
3. Add Particulars and Shading
To refine the cat ears, add some element traces alongside the interior and outer edges. These traces will recommend the creases and folds of the ears. You may also draw curved traces close to the underside of the ears to create a extra pure look.
Lastly, add shading to offer the ears depth. Darken the areas across the crevices and the underside edges of the ears to create a 3D impact. You may also frivolously shade the interior a part of the ears to make them seem concave.
Creating Reasonable Fur Texture
To attain a sensible fur texture, emulate the next strategies:
1. Fluctuate the Size and Width of Hair Strands
Draw hair strands in assorted lengths and widths. This creates a pure look, as fur not often grows uniformly. Use shorter and thinner strokes for the bottom layer, and longer and thicker ones for the highest layers.
2. Use a Mixture of Brushes
Experiment with completely different brushes to create completely different fur textures. Smooth brushes with rounded edges produce a easy, velvety impact, whereas brushes with sharp edges create a extra wiry texture. Mix completely different brushes to realize a steadiness of softness and definition.
3. Render Path of Fur Progress
Take note of the pure path of fur progress. Begin by sketching the general form of the ear after which draw the hair strands following the curves and contours of the shape. Use easy, flowing strokes to recommend the path of fur progress. This meticulous method will create a sensible phantasm of texture and depth.

Including Highlights and Shading
After getting utilized the bottom shade to your cat ears, you’ll be able to add some highlights and shading to offer them extra depth. To do that, you will want to decide on a lighter shade of your base shade for the highlights and a darker shade for the shadows. You possibly can then use a mushy brush or sponge to use the highlights and shadows to your drawing.
When including highlights and shadows, it is vital to consider the place the sunshine supply is coming from. This can provide help to create a extra reasonable impact. For instance, if the sunshine supply is coming from the highest, you’ll add highlights to the highest of your cat ears and shadows to the underside.

Utilizing Reference Images
Reference images are extraordinarily useful when drawing cat ears, as they supply a wealth of visible details about their form, texture, and shading. The next steps will information you thru the method of utilizing reference images successfully:
1. Choose Excessive-High quality Images:
Select clear and well-lit images that showcase the ear construction from a number of angles. Shut-up photographs can present intricate particulars, whereas facet and profile views can assist you perceive the ear’s three-dimensional nature.
2. Examine the Shapes and Curvature:
Take note of the general form of the ear, together with the bottom, interior curve, and outer rim. Discover the refined curvatures that give the ear its attribute kind.
3. Observe the Texture and Particulars:
Pay attention to the feel of the fur, the path of hair progress, and some other high quality particulars seen within the picture. These components will add realism to your drawing.
4. Take a look at the Shading and Lighting:
Study the best way mild and shadow fall on the ear. Determine the highlights, mid-tones, and shadows to create a way of depth and quantity in your drawing.
5. Break Down the Ear into Shapes:
Divide the ear into easier shapes or sections, reminiscent of triangles, ovals, and curved traces. This can make it simpler to attract the ear precisely and proportionally.
6. Use Grids or Tracing Paper (Non-obligatory):
To make sure accuracy, you should utilize a grid system or hint the define of the ear from the reference picture onto your drawing paper. This may be notably useful for newcomers.
7. Experiment with Totally different Drawing Methods:
Discover varied drawing strategies to seize the essence of the cat ear. Experiment with pencil strokes, charcoal, or digital instruments to create completely different textures and results. Attempt mixing, shading, and hatching to realize depth and realism.
